Striking for climate justice is not specifically on this list, but WikiHow has a pretty comprehensive list of Simple Ways to Help Save the Earth.

Please don’t tell me these suggestions are simplistic, naive, or too small to make a difference. If you read the list, you’ll see that some items are to join movements or put pressure on people who can make big changes.

Meanwhile, little changes can add up. Our little actions helped make this mess; our little actions can help mitigate and heal the damage.
